Current US Market Value
The SBGA031 price in the US currently sits at a median of $3,972, with the middle half of transactions ranging from $3,500 to $4,850. That spread is meaningful. It tells you that condition, box-and-papers status, and seller positioning are doing significant work on this reference. Buyers hunting at the low end of that range can find well-priced examples; sellers asking near $4,850 are typically presenting complete sets in excellent condition. It is worth noting that the comp base here is rated 🟡 Limited, meaning the sample size is small and these figures should be treated as directional rather than definitive. As more transactions are recorded, the confidence band will tighten. For now, use the $3,500 to $4,000 zone as the realistic target window for a solid buy on the SBGA031 for sale in the US gray market.
Active JDM Listings
Japan has shown consistent SBGA031 supply over the past two weeks, with listings appearing across both Yahoo Shop and direct JP auction platforms. Prices in yen have clustered in a range that, after currency conversion and landed costs, aligns with the lower end of the US market window. If you are looking to buy SBGA031 Japan, the current listing environment is reasonably active.
- May 31: ¥628,000 on Yahoo Shop
- May 31: ¥514,800 on Yahoo Shop
- May 30: ¥628,002 on JP auction
- May 30: ¥514,800 on JP auction
- May 26: ¥492,800 on JP auction
The bifurcation between the ¥492,000 to ¥515,000 tier and the ¥628,000 tier likely reflects condition and completeness differences, though listing condition grades were not available in the current data pull. That gap of roughly ¥130,000 between tiers is large enough to matter significantly when calculating landed margins.

Japan vs. US Price Gap
The US-Japan price gap on the SBGA031 is driven by a combination of factors typical for premium Grand Seiko divers. Japanese sellers often price for domestic buyers who are sensitive to originality and provenance but less focused on the US resale ceiling, and the yen's current position against the dollar has extended that gap further than it would appear in nominal yen terms. Buyers who have reliable forwarding infrastructure and can accurately assess condition remotely will be best positioned to work this spread. The primary risk factor to acknowledge is comp thinness. With a limited transaction sample underpinning the $3,972 US median, a single bad comp or a softening in demand could move that number, and buyers relying on the current median as a guaranteed exit price should build in additional margin buffer.
